This target gene encodes the protein 'prostaglandin E receptor 4' in humans and may also be known as Ptger, EP4, EP4R, prostaglandin E2 receptor EP4 subtype, and PGE receptor, EP4 subtype. Structurally, the protein is reported to be 53.1 kilodaltons in mass. Based on gene name, canine, porcine, monkey, mouse and rat orthologs may also be found.
